diff options
author | Rémi Cardona <remi.cardona@free.fr> | 2014-09-22 16:55:01 +0200 |
---|---|---|
committer | Rémi Cardona <remi.cardona@free.fr> | 2014-09-22 16:55:01 +0200 |
commit | 72bc9434015bd6453add8869fdff951fe12735db (patch) | |
tree | ed85c877f6426124b8faa75532fd47d5a69dbb68 | |
parent | 41177464eaff4aed29ac31c94b31d3720c0c1b63 (diff) | |
download | logilab-common-72bc9434015bd6453add8869fdff951fe12735db.tar.gz |
Consistently use the generator version of range
That way we get the same behavior on python2 and python3.
-rw-r--r-- | __init__.py | 3 | ||||
-rw-r--r-- | configuration.py | 1 | ||||
-rw-r--r-- | daemon.py | 2 | ||||
-rw-r--r-- | dbf.py | 2 | ||||
-rw-r--r-- | modutils.py | 2 | ||||
-rw-r--r-- | table.py | 1 | ||||
-rw-r--r-- | test/unittest_table.py | 2 | ||||
-rw-r--r-- | ureports/docbook_writer.py | 2 | ||||
-rw-r--r-- | ureports/html_writer.py | 2 | ||||
-rw-r--r-- | ureports/text_writer.py | 2 |
10 files changed, 19 insertions, 0 deletions
diff --git a/__init__.py b/__init__.py index 8d063e2..7b06bb1 100644 --- a/__init__.py +++ b/__init__.py @@ -25,6 +25,9 @@ :var IGNORED_EXTENSIONS: file extensions that may usually be ignored """ __docformat__ = "restructuredtext en" + +from six.moves import range + from logilab.common.__pkginfo__ import version as __version__ STD_BLACKLIST = ('CVS', '.svn', '.hg', 'debian', 'dist', 'build') diff --git a/configuration.py b/configuration.py index 77a636f..58746b0 100644 --- a/configuration.py +++ b/configuration.py @@ -124,6 +124,7 @@ from ConfigParser import ConfigParser from warnings import warn from six import string_types +from six.moves import range from logilab.common.compat import raw_input, str_encode as _encode from logilab.common.deprecation import deprecated @@ -26,6 +26,8 @@ import sys import time import warnings +from six.moves import range + def setugid(user): """Change process user and group ID @@ -37,6 +37,8 @@ import sys import csv import tempfile +from six.moves import range + class Dbase: def __init__(self): self.fdb = None diff --git a/modutils.py b/modutils.py index 1ccf09e..bff0c91 100644 --- a/modutils.py +++ b/modutils.py @@ -37,6 +37,8 @@ from imp import find_module, load_module, C_BUILTIN, PY_COMPILED, PKG_DIRECTORY from distutils.sysconfig import get_config_var, get_python_lib, get_python_version from distutils.errors import DistutilsPlatformError +from six.moves import range + try: import zipimport except ImportError: @@ -21,6 +21,7 @@ from __future__ import print_function __docformat__ = "restructuredtext en" +from six.moves import range class Table(object): """Table defines a data table with column and row names. diff --git a/test/unittest_table.py b/test/unittest_table.py index 49dbf10..362e8ce 100644 --- a/test/unittest_table.py +++ b/test/unittest_table.py @@ -24,6 +24,8 @@ import sys import os from cStringIO import StringIO +from six.moves import range + from logilab.common.testlib import TestCase, unittest_main from logilab.common.table import Table, TableStyleSheet, DocbookTableWriter, \ DocbookRenderer, TableStyle, TableWriter, TableCellRenderer diff --git a/ureports/docbook_writer.py b/ureports/docbook_writer.py index a520364..857068c 100644 --- a/ureports/docbook_writer.py +++ b/ureports/docbook_writer.py @@ -18,6 +18,8 @@ """HTML formatting drivers for ureports""" __docformat__ = "restructuredtext en" +from six.moves import range + from logilab.common.ureports import HTMLWriter class DocbookWriter(HTMLWriter): diff --git a/ureports/html_writer.py b/ureports/html_writer.py index 1d09503..faca90b 100644 --- a/ureports/html_writer.py +++ b/ureports/html_writer.py @@ -20,6 +20,8 @@ __docformat__ = "restructuredtext en" from cgi import escape +from six.moves import range + from logilab.common.ureports import BaseWriter diff --git a/ureports/text_writer.py b/ureports/text_writer.py index 88a046a..a25cf26 100644 --- a/ureports/text_writer.py +++ b/ureports/text_writer.py @@ -21,6 +21,8 @@ from __future__ import print_function __docformat__ = "restructuredtext en" +from six.moves import range + from logilab.common.textutils import linesep from logilab.common.ureports import BaseWriter |